When selecting stainless steel materials for industrial applications, two common choices are SUS304 and SUS201 stainless steels. Both are austenitic stainless steels that offer a good balance of strength, formability, and corrosion resistance, but they have distinct differences in terms of cost, performance, and suitability for various applications. This article compares SUS304 vs SUS201, with a focus on key performance differences, cost analysis, and applications, helping procurement professionals make the right material choice.

SUS304 vs SUS201: Performance, Cost and Applications

 

What is SUS201 Stainless Steel?


SUS201 is another austenitic stainless steel but with a lower nickel content compared to SUS304. This makes it a cost-effective alternative while still offering decent corrosion resistance and good strength. However, it is more susceptible to corrosion in harsh environments, particularly those exposed to chlorides or acidic conditions.

 

Key Features of SUS201:
Lower Cost: With reduced nickel and manganese content, SUS201 is a more economical option compared to SUS304.
Corrosion Resistance: Offers moderate corrosion resistance, making it suitable for mild environments, but not ideal for marine or highly corrosive applications.
Formability and Strength: Exhibits good strength and ductility, making it easy to form and fabricate.

 

 

What is SUS304 Stainless Steel?

 

SUS304, also known as 304 stainless steel, is one of the most commonly used grades of stainless steel. It is part of the austenitic family, meaning it has a non-magnetic structure and exhibits excellent corrosion resistance in a wide range of environments, including food processing, chemical industries, and architectural applications.

 

Key Features of SUS304:
Corrosion Resistance: Excellent in mild corrosive environments, including water and food-grade environments.
Formability and Weldability: Easy to form and weld, making it versatile for a wide range of applications.
Aesthetic Appeal: It maintains a clean, shiny finish suitable for architectural and decorative applications.

 

 

SUS304 vs SUS201: Key Differences

 Chemical Composition Comparison: SUS304 vs SUS201

Element SUS304 (304 Stainless Steel) SUS201 (201 Stainless Steel)
Nickel (Ni) 8.0–10.5% 3.5–5.5%
Chromium (Cr) 18.0–20.0% 16.0–18.0%
Manganese (Mn) 2.0% max 5.5–7.5%
Carbon (C) ≤0.08% ≤0.15%
Silicon (Si) 0.75% max 0.75% max
Sulfur (S) 0.03% max 0.03% max
Iron (Fe) Balance Balance

SUS201 contains less nickel and more manganese compared to SUS304, which makes it less corrosion-resistant but more cost-effective.

SUS304 has better overall performance due to its higher nickel content, which contributes to improved strength, corrosion resistance, and weldability.

 

Performance Comparison: SUS304 vs SUS201

Property SUS304 (304 Stainless Steel) SUS201 (201 Stainless Steel)
Tensile Strength 520–720 MPa 520–750 MPa
Yield Strength 215–505 MPa 275–505 MPa
Elongation ≥40% ≥40%
Hardness 170–200 HB (Rockwell B) 160–190 HB (Rockwell B)
Density 8.0 g/cm³ 7.9 g/cm³
Modulus of Elasticity 200 GPa 200 GPa

 

 Corrosion Resistance: SUS304 vs SUS201

Environment SUS304 (304 Stainless Steel) SUS201 (201 Stainless Steel)
Mild Acids (e.g., citric acid) Excellent Good
Oxidizing Acids Excellent Moderate
Chlorides (e.g., seawater) Moderate Poor to Moderate
Marine Environments Good Poor

Strength Differences Between SUS304 and SUS201
In the annealed state, the minimum tensile strength of these two grades is similar, both approximately ≥520 MPa. However, the yield strength of SUS201 is generally higher than that of SUS304 (SUS201 ≥275 MPa, SUS304 ≥205 MPa), and SUS201 exhibits greater work hardening, reaching approximately 700–1000 MPa after cold working, while the strength of SUS304 is typically between 515–690 MPa, depending on the tempering state.

 

Price Differences Between SUS304 and SUS201
Due to its lower nickel content and higher manganese/nitrogen content, SUS201 is typically 20%–30% cheaper than SUS304. Recently, in the Chinese domestic market, the price of SUS201 is approximately 18.0 RMB/kg, while SUS304 is approximately 28.8 RMB/kg, a price difference of about 55%–60%. Actual prices may vary depending on the product form, thickness, and manufacturer.
